Abstract:Conservation has embraced advances in big data and related digital technologies as key to preventing biodiversity loss, especially in the identification of areas of conservation priority based on spatial data, which we call the big geospatial data turn. This turn has led to the proliferation of useful methods and tools, including global geospatial maps.
